The original cross symbol holds significance in religious iconography as a representation of sacrifice and salvation in Christianity. Over time, the cross has evolved to symbolize different aspects of faith, such as hope, forgiveness, and redemption. Its enduring presence in religious art and culture reflects its central role in Christian beliefs and practices.

What is the significance of the ancestral allele in understanding genetic inheritance and evolution?

The ancestral allele is important in understanding genetic inheritance and evolution because it represents the original form of a gene in a population. By studying the ancestral allele, scientists can track how genetic variations have evolved over time and how they are passed down through generations. This information helps researchers understand the genetic basis of traits and how they have changed over time, providing insights into the mechanisms of evolution.


Why is Mogan David wine thought to be Jewish?

Post WWII Jewish immigrants to the US often had little money and were attracted to Mogen David because it is kosher, had a low low price , and had the name David in the brand which was (is) of religious significance. It is rumored that the original MD label resembled a Jewish religious ornament as well.

What does exegeting mean?

Exegeting means interpreting or explaining the meaning of a text, particularly a religious or sacred text, in order to understand its significance and implications for belief and practice. It involves analyzing the historical context, language, and cultural background to gain a deeper understanding of the original meaning of the text.
